"Flyer Nation" Online Broadcast
 
Episode One
In this inaugural episode of Flyer Nation, News Center 7's Sport Director Mike Hartsock talks about UD Men's Basketball Head Coach Anthony Grant's second season as coach, gives an update on UD Arena construction, talks to Capital University head coach regarding their upcoming Exhibition game with the Flyers and also gives us a look at the Lady Flyers Basketball Season.
